Washougal River Road, Old Washington State Route 140

The WRR is one of the best motorcycle roads in Clark County. It has great pavement, twisty sections, tight blind corners, and a beautiful river to travel next to. There is also something here to make the trip a little less fun: lots of traffic. This road can be empty, or packed. Washington State Route 11 ‘Chuckanut Drive’

Chuckanut Drive is a bit of a throwback. As anyone in Western Washington knows, this road is narrow, tight, and often terribly busy. It’s also quite scenic, and that’s what most of the cagers are going there for.
